U.S. Mobile Advertising Market to Reach $3 Billion By 2014

The strategic and financial media company, BIA/Kelsey, released a new report today that shows a forecast of revenues in the U.S. mobile advertising industry over the next four years. The forecast shows a growth from $491 million in 2009 to 2.9 billion in 2014.
